Other neighbourhoods around Malvaglio

San Siro
Noted for its shopping and restaurants, there's plenty to explore in San Siro. Top attractions like San Siro Stadium and San Siro Race Course are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at San Siro Ippodromo M5 Tram Stop or San Siro Ippodromo Station to see more of the city.

Washington
While you're in Washington, take in top sights like Corso Vercelli or Teatro Ventaglio Nazionale,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Corso Vercelli - Via Cherubini Tram Stop or Piazza Piemonte Tram Stop.

Magenta
Noted for its churches and shopping, there's plenty to explore in Magenta. Top attractions like Museum of the Last Supper and Santa Maria delle Grazie are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at Piazza Virgilio Tram Stop or Via Monti - Piazza Virgilio Tram Stop to see more of the city.

Porta Genova
Noted for its art galleries and cafes, there's plenty to explore in Porta Genova. Top attractions like Via Tortona and MUDEC - Museo delle Culture are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at Via Valenza Alzaia Nav. Grande Tram Stop or Porta Genova Station to see more of the city.
